
Timbers Sign Santiago Moreno to Contract Extension
Published on January 26, 2024 under Major League Soccer (MLS)
Portland Timbers News Release
PORTLAND, Ore. - The Portland Timbers today announced that the club signed midfielder Santiago Moreno to a contract extension through the 2026 season with a club option in 2027.
"Santi has become an influential component of our attack since joining Portland as a young player a few years ago. He has taken necessary steps in his maturation on and off the field, which has been vital for his growth," said Timbers General Manager Ned Grabavoy. "Santi has the capability to continue to raise his level, and we're excited to see him become an even more significant contributor with our group moving forward."
The 2024 MLS season will mark Moreno's fourth with the club. Since making his debut for the Timbers on Aug. 29, 2021, the Colombian international has registered 10 goals and 21 assists in 78 appearances (60 starts), tallying more assists and points (41) than any other Timbers player in that span. On Sept. 30, 2023, Moreno became the youngest player in franchise history to record double digit goals and assists for the Timbers at 23 years and 162 days old, surpassing Darlington Nagbe, the previous youngest at 23 years and 288 days old on May 3, 2014.
In the 2023 campaign, Moreno led the team in appearances (31), successful dribbles (59), duels won (163) and assists with nine, a new career best for the 23-year-old attacker. Notably, he notched four game-winning assists last year. In his first full season for the team in 2022, Moreno tallied seven goals and eight assists in 34 appearances (28 starts), leading the team in matches played, points (22), chances created (55) and successful dribbles (75).
At the international level, Moreno has earned two caps for the Colombian National Team. He debuted for the senior squad in a friendly match against Paraguay on Nov. 19, 2022, and made his second appearance in a friendly match against the U.S. Men's National Team on January 28, 2023.
